How they compare

Angola currently reports 7.2% against 6.4% in Ethiopia, a difference of 0.8%.

That makes Angola's figure about 1.1 times Ethiopia's.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 35 shared years of data; in 1991 it was Angola ahead.

Angola ranks 181st and Ethiopia ranks 183rd of 187 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Angola averaged higher in 3 and Ethiopia in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Angola Ethiopia Difference Ahead
1990s 7.7% 6.6% 1.2% Angola
2000s 8.1% 7.2% 0.9% Angola
2010s 7.0% 7.8% 0.8% Ethiopia
2020s 6.7% 6.4% 0.3% Angola

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Employment is defined as persons of working age who were engaged in any activity to produce goods or provide services for pay or profit, whether at work during the reference period or not at work due to temporary absence from a job, or to working-time arrangement. The industry sector consists of mining and quarrying, manufacturing, construction, and public utilities (electricity, gas, and water), in accordance with divisions 2-5 (ISIC 2) or categories C-F (ISIC 3) or categories B-F (ISIC 4).
